## Changelog — DiffScope 4.2.1 (key rotation)

This release rotates the signing key for DiffScope, our large-file diff viewer, following the scheduled annual rotation. No functional changes are included. Verification of 4.2.0 and earlier continues to work via the archived key in the trust bundle. All artifacts from 4.2.1 onward, including the streaming-chunk renderer, are signed with the new key below.

release key, fahop-bahip: bky19_PspfQHRyvVcYD9LdZgo

The Tollgate rules engine computes shipping fees for all Parcelwick orders. Rules are evaluated top-down; the first matching rule wins, so ordering matters more than it looks. Never edit rules directly in the database — changes must go through the staged rollout tool, which validates for overlapping conditions and dead rules. Before touching anything, read the evaluation-order semantics and the rollback procedure, both documented on the internal page below.

wiki page, kagep-bajog: https://sentry.braskdata.internal/issue

**Ticket PARITY-412: Kestrel SDK catch-up**

Quick one for the weekly sync: the Kestrel-Go SDK is still missing batched uploads and retry hints that Kestrel-JS shipped two releases ago. Partner teams keep asking. Plan is to land both behind a flag this sprint and cut a minor release. Needs a sign-off from the owner named below.

account owner for bajef-badup: Drueth Kelath Pelael Holwyn

Audit item: legacy ORM layer in Bramblecore is being refactored to the new query builder. Support impact: ticket lookups may be slower during migration windows. Escalate any customer-visible timeouts via the Fennick queue. Do not retry bulk exports manually. Migration completes end of sprint. The owner accountable for sign-off is listed below.

approver of bagug-bagag = Holael Pramir

Telemetry payloads sent to the Densift ingest endpoint must be zstd-compressed. Uncompressed bodies over 4KB return 413. Plugins built on the Corvid SDK get compression automatically; raw HTTP clients must set the encoding header themselves. Batching is optional but recommended — the endpoint charges quota per request, not per byte. Dictionary training is handled server-side; do not ship custom dictionaries. All requests, plugin or raw, authenticate against the internal Densift gateway using the key that follows.

API key for yahig-tadup: kto7_ubizbYm